Option Name stat_export
Usage stat_export <stats file>
Description

Output is sent to stdout

Attention: the output can contain ANSI ESC sequence which may affect terminal controls.

Output format:

FEATURE, UTF-8 text, Ham count, Spam count, Total count, Non-existent count, Spam-Bait count, Trusted source count, Common seen traffic, Seen Spam traffic , Seen Ham traffic, Common traffic index, Common spam index, Common ham index, Unique images index, GREY PASS or FAIL switch index, IP specific traffic index, GREY invoked, GREY temp fail during delay, GREY passed, GREY auto white passed, GREY auto white expired, GREY switched count, Message with unique images count, Message with images count, IP specific seen traffic, SPF_PASSED, SPF_SFAIL, SPF_HFAIL, DK_STAT_OK, DK_STAT_BADSIG

IP feature has extended list of attributes in addition to common:

25 port status can be 0(filtered state), 1 (port is open), 2(port is closed)
TCP flags TCP packet header flags (SYN=2, ACK, RST, etc., see rfc 793 for details)
IP ID IP packet identification number (see rfc 791 for details)
IP TTL IP packet time to live value
IP Flags IP fragmentation flags
TCP Window size TCP window size of sending party (see rfc 793 for details)
